In contrast to the regular ones, which can detect only single drug, a multi-panel kit looks for various drugs using a single sample. In this article, we will know how beneficial they are at workplaces.

These kits are similar to the regular ones except for the fact that they can detect 2 to 12 drugs at a time using a single specimen. The various drugs which can be detected by these test kits are Marijuana, Cocaine, Methamphetamine, Opiates, Benzodiazepines, Amphetamines, Methadone, Phencyclidine, Barbiturates, Tricyclic Antidepressants, Ecstacy, Propoxyphene (PPX), Buprenorphine, Oxycodone, etc.

5 Panel drug test kits that detect SAMHSA 5 drugs (previously called as NIDA 5) are popular at workplaces. SAMHSA 5 drugs include Marijuana (THC), Cocaine (COC), Amphetamines (AMP), Opiates (OPI) and Phencyclidine (PCP).

Why prefer them:
Testing employees using single drug test kits is associated with some issues such as repeated procedures, employee privacy, higher testing costs, etc. The usage of multi-panel kits helps the employers cut down on all these problems. Listed below are few benefits:

Check for multiple drugs: They check for the most popularly used drugs, as well as some uncommon illicit drugs of abuse. This leaves no chance for the employee to escape from being identified for his drug abuse. Employees can rarely afford or use the drugs which are not detected by them.

Comfortable for employees: These test kits can detect many drugs of abuse using a single specimen. Hence, the employer need not approach the employee every time for sample collection. This makes the testing convenient and less invasive for the employees.

Save costs: Testing every employee for each and every drug, by using drug specific kits will increase the drug testing costs for the employers. Instead, opting for multi-panel kits will reduce the costs, by enabling the employer to use one single kit to test for a combination of various drugs.

Simple and easy to use: Employers can use these test kits easily like any other drug test kits. Also, these simple to use kits do not require any professional assistance, which makes them perfect to be used at workplaces anytime.

Quick and accurate results: These kits bought from a reputed dealer adhere to the SAMHSA cut-off levels. These are also FDA approved. Hence, the results given by these kits are highly reliable and accurate. Moreover, these kits do not take more than 5 minutes to show the results, making it possible to take quick action against drug usage.
